Northern Lights on the Kola Peninsula, Russia | otdih.pro

Northern Lights on the Kola Peninsula, Russia1 photos

Northern Lights on the Kola Peninsula, Russia - 1

Find the Best Professionals for Your Project

Expert repair, construction, and renovation specialists ready to help you right now

Recommended Galleries

Recommended articles